Correct WinUAE settings for AmigaSys4
Well, I just did something really stupid - I accidentally wrote over my AmigaSYS4 configuration setting file in WinUAE with a standard stock A1200 config.
I don't want to have to re-install AmigaSYS4 from scratch. I think that as long as I get the right settings in WinUAE and then save a config file - then everything should be OK. I got it to boot-up to desktop, but then it gives error messages for "Iprefs" and "Birdie". I'm guessing that I don't have the right ram settings or something similar. |

Here is the original config from the installation file. You could have done this yourself. Both 7Zip and WinRAR can examine .exe files for contained fles, especially if they are self-extracting archives.
